Sourcing guidance for Plastic Stackable Kids Chair
What are the key material specifications to look for in high-quality plastic kids' chairs?
Prioritize chairs made from High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E) or Polypropylene (PP), as these materials offer the best balance of durability and safety. Ensure the plastic is BPA-free, non-toxic, and lead-free. For outdoor or classroom use near windows, verify that the material includes UV-stabilizers to prevent fading and brittleness over time.
Which safety and compliance standards are mandatory for international markets?
For the US market, products must comply with CPSIA (Consumer Product Safety Improvement Act) and ASTM F963-17. For the EU, EN 71 (Safety of Toys) and REACH certifications are essential. Ensure the design features rounded edges, non-slip feet, and a stable anti-tip structure to prevent childhood injuries.
How does the stackable design impact logistics and product longevity?
A well-engineered stackable design should allow for high-density nesting (typically 10-15 chairs high) to reduce shipping volumes and warehousing costs. Look for chairs with reinforced ribbing under the seat to prevent warping under the weight of the stack, and ensure there are protective buffers to prevent scratching during stacking and unstacking.
What ergonomic features should be considered for different age groups?
Select chairs with a contoured backrest to support spinal alignment and a waterfall seat edge to reduce pressure on small legs. Seat heights typically range from 10 to 14 inches; ensure the supplier provides a size chart mapped to age groups (2-7 years) to meet the specific needs of preschools or daycare centers.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Kids' Furniture

What are the common risks in shipping plastic furniture and how to mitigate them?
The primary risk is deformation due to heat in containers or cracking due to rough handling. Request 5-layer corrugated export cartons and internal PE bag protection. For large volumes, use FCL (Full Container Load) to minimize handling, and ensure the Incoterms (e.g., FOB or CIF) clearly define the point of risk transfer.
How should I negotiate pricing and MOQs for customized colors or branding?
Standard colors usually have lower MOQs (e.g., 100 units), but custom Pantone matching may require 500-1000 units. Negotiate a tiered pricing structure where the unit price drops by 5-10% as volume increases. Always request a pre-production sample to verify color accuracy and logo placement before authorizing mass production.
What payment security measures should be implemented for large B2B transactions?
Utilize Secured Trading Services offered through the platform to ensure your payment is held in escrow until shipping documents are verified. Follow a 30/70 payment term (30% deposit, 70% balance against the Bill of Lading) and consider a third-party pre-shipment inspection to confirm quality before the final payment is released.
